- Scope and Content
- Item is a photograph of the Royal Navy cruiser HMS Dauntless in the First Narrows. The mouth of the Capilano River, Sentinel Hill and the North Shore mountains are in the background. This is either during the visit to Vancouver of the Empire Cruise (1924) or during a later visit in 1930.
